When your car's brake assist malfunctions, a typical culprit is a defective ABS control module. This guide will walk you through the steps of replacing this critical component. First, you’ll need to locate the ABS unit, which is usually found behind the glove compartment or under the driver's seat. Disconnecting the battery is a essential step before you start any repairs. Next, carefully disconnect the wiring harnesses from the computer, paying close attention their locations for reassembly. Finally, install the updated ABS controller, attach the connectors, and re-establish the power. Remember to have the new module coded by a qualified mechanic after installation, as this step is usually necessary for correct functionality.

ABS Module Replacement Cost & Considerations
Replacing your vehicle's anti-lock braking system can be a significant outlay, generally sitting between roughly $500 and $1500. This price fluctuates based on several factors , including the brand and version of your car . Labor charges represent a major piece of the complete invoice , often accounting for $200 to $500 alone. Factory parts are typically greater pricey than replacement options. It's important to get multiple estimates from trusted garages before making with the replacement . Finally, consider that some repair facilities might suggest replacing the entire ABS unit instead of just the damaged module itself, further increasing the final cost .

ABS Module Replacement: DIY vs. Professional Help
Replacing an ABS can be a tricky task, and deciding whether to tackle it yourself or seek qualified assistance is a important consideration. A do-it-yourself approach can lower costs , but requires a considerable understanding of automotive systems , specialized tools , and the ability to identify potential complications. Conversely, a technician at a garage possesses the experience and troubleshooting equipment to precisely replace the module and ensure proper functionality , mitigating the risk of further damage to your vehicle . Therefore, weigh your expertise and confidence carefully before attempting this procedure.
